1. Researching Training Methods: Favorable Support vs. Others

When it concerns picking the right dog trainer in Charlotte, NC, comprehending the different training techniques is vital. One of the most efficient and widely suggested techniques is positive reinforcement, which focuses on fulfilling desirable behaviors instead of penalizing undesirable ones. This technique motivates your dog to repeat good behaviors by associating them with favorable results, such as treats, praise, or playtime. It produces a relying on relationship in between you and your furry buddy, making training a more pleasurable experience for both of you.

On the other hand, other training methods, such as dominance-based or aversive training, may depend on corrections or unfavorable support. While some trainers promote for these techniques, they can often result in fear, stress and anxiety, and even aggressiveness in dogs. The goal ought to always be to promote a favorable knowing environment where your dog feels safe and determined to learn.

When researching prospective trainers, inquire about their chosen training approaches and approaches. Try to find accreditations from reliable organizations, such as the Association of Expert Dog Trainers (APDT) or the Certification Council for Expert Dog Trainers (CCPDT), which frequently suggests a dedication to favorable support methods. Furthermore, check out reviews and testimonials from other dog owners to evaluate their experiences and the effectiveness of the trainer's techniques.

Ultimately, selecting a trainer who aligns with your values and prioritizes your dog's well-being will make sure a effective training journey. By concentrating on favorable reinforcement, you'll not only improve your dog's behavior but likewise reinforce the bond you share, leading the way for a delighted and unified life together.

3. Interviewing Potential Trainers: Secret Concerns to Ask

Discovering the ideal dog trainer for your furry buddy is important for promoting a pleased and harmonious relationship between you and your pet. As you embark on this journey, interviewing potential trainers is a essential action that can assist you make an notified decision. Here are some key questions you need to think about asking throughout your interviews to guarantee that you select the best suitable for you and your dog.

- What training approaches do you utilize?
Understanding a trainer's philosophy and strategies is necessary. Some trainers might depend on positive support, while others may utilize different approaches. Request information on their approach and how they customize their training to match different dog temperaments and finding out designs. This will help you assess whether their approaches align with your worths and your dog's needs.

- What is your experience and qualifications?
Ask about the trainer's background, certifications, and experience in dog training. A qualified trainer needs to be skilled in canine behavior, training strategies, and even first aid. Do not be reluctant to ask about their continuing education efforts in the field, as a dedication to ongoing knowing is a great indicator of a devoted professional.

- Can you supply recommendations or reviews?
Requesting referrals or reviews from previous clients can give you insight into the trainer's efficiency and the experiences of other dog owners. A trusted trainer will be more than delighted to share success stories or connect you with previous customers who can talk to their training design and results.

- How do you examine a dog's behavior and requirements?
Every dog is unique, and a great trainer needs to have a process for examining behavior and customizing their approach accordingly. Ask how they examine a dog's character, finding out capabilities, and any behavioral problems. This will assist you evaluate their capability to provide individualized training.

- What is the structure of your training classes?
Comprehending the format of the training sessions-- whether they are one-on-one or group classes, for how long they last, and what abilities will be covered-- can help you identify if it fulfills your expectations. Inquire about the trainer's method to socialization, as this can be a vital element of training.

- What happens if my dog doesn't react to training?
Every dog finds out at its own pace, and difficulties might emerge. Ask the trainer how they handle circumstances where a dog is having a hard time to find out or exhibit preferred habits. Their action will expose their flexibility, patience, and problem-solving abilities.
